If you're certain that you're not pregnant, the first thing I considered was "does it really feel like a kick?" I guess that depends on whether or not you've actually been pregnant and had a real "kick" or not.

The kicking sensation you are feeling is simply your intestines moving food and waste through your digestive tract at a higher rate. This is fairly common and should not be concerning unless you experience symptoms that are painful or last for prolonged periods of time. If you are still concerned discuss your symptoms with your doctor.
